Panda awareness campaign in Malaysia
Panda sculptures is exhibited during the 1,600 Pandas World Tour at National Monument in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ia on January 9, 2015. The 1,600 Pandas World Tour is a collaboration between WWF and French artist Paulo Grangeon is in Malaysia to promote the panda conservation. Grangeon has created 1600 Panda scupture in various poses using recycled paper in symbolic to represent the amount of pandas left in the wild. (Photo by Ahmad Yusni/NurPhoto)
